Output 4906481786f3f08310dcc666ee3968048de8a6ee1b19ecadd05a0b4aa19f3e87:1

value
3768995215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681edc4b7b4281e1067213fbf8fcc5f01a436497 OP_EQUAL
address
MHPhUcC2HvJXGVaTQ879uuc38pqxpk2Sy3
transaction
4906481786f3f08310dcc666ee3968048de8a6ee1b19ecadd05a0b4aa19f3e87
spent
true